The Joint, Office of the Secretary of War, Interagency Division provides expert support services to a range of customers spanning across the Department of War, Federal Civilian, and international markets. JOID provides a diverse portfolio of analytical and programmatic capabilities to help our customers make informed decisions on their most challenging issues.

The Acquisition and Technology Analysis Group within JOID specializes in the application of multi-disciplinary analytic skills to support multiple clients within the Department of War (DoW). These clients include the Office of the Under Secretary of War for Research and Engineering (OUSW(R&E)), Office of the Under Secretary of War for Acquisition and Sustainment (OUSW(A&S)), Office of the Under Secretary of War for Personnel and Readiness (OUSW(P&R)) and the Joint Staff. SPA provides critical decision support to enabling and executing a strategy of technological superiority and enabling the delivery and sustainment of secure, resilient, and preeminent capabilities to the warfighter quickly and cost effectively. Our team of experienced military, technical, and operations research analysts is skilled in evaluating military problems, identifying the driving factors, devising innovative approaches, collecting applicable data, developing necessary software tools, and performing thorough and timely assessments to inform technology and acquisition governance decisions to ensure U.S. military forces retain military superiority in the future.

We have an upcoming need for an Acquisition Analyst to provide onsite support in Arlington, VA.

Responsibilities

The Acquisition Analyst will support Department of War (DoW) Acquisition Transformation efforts. Will serve as a core team member supporting the OASW(A) Acquisition Transformation Senior Advisory Group (SAG), working with internal and external experts to translate senior-level guidance into actionable, implementation-ready recommendations for OASW(A) and DoW leadership. Will track implementation progress to enable rapid senior leader decision making and accelerate execution; manage workflows and dependencies across all 38 Secretary-directed transformation tasks; drive a culture of accountability across the DoW and the Services by following actions from inception through completion; and ensure strategic alignment among all stakeholders. Apply extensive experience with the DoW acquisition process, a comprehensive understanding of DoW program management and how programs progress through the acquisition lifecycle, and demonstrated ability to work closely and confidently with senior DoW leadership at the ASW and USW levels.
